| Application: | Dimethyl 2,6-dibromoheptanedioate may be used in the following studies: • Preparation of difunctional poly(n-butyl acrylate) (pBA) macroinitiator. • As initiator for the synthesis of dibromo-terminated polystyrene, via atom transfer radical polymerization (ATRP). • Preparation of polytrithiocarbonate, which serves as Reversible Addition-Fragmentation chain Transfer (RAFT) agent for radical polymerization reactions. |
| General description: | Dimethyl 2,6-dibromoheptanedioate acts as a bifunctional initiator in various polymerization reactions. Its electrochemical cyclization affords high yields of three- to six-membered dimethyl 1,2-cycloalkanedicarboxyl |
